Huonville, Tasmania, Australia

Overview

Set along the Huon River in Tasmania's picturesque south, Huonville is a gateway to the scenic Huon Valley. Known for its apple orchards, tranquil rural landscape, and artisan spirit, this town offers visitors a taste of Tasmania's natural and culinary riches.

Best Time to Visit

October to April for warm weather, fruit harvests, and local festivals.

Local Tips

A car is highly recommended to explore the valley and surrounding attractions. Many shops close early, especially on weekends, so plan ahead.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is not customary but appreciated. Dress is casual and weather-appropriate; layering is important as temperatures can change quickly.

Safety Warnings

Generally very safe, but be cautious driving after dark due to wildlife crossings. Occasional river flooding can affect low-lying areas in heavy rain.

Hidden Gems

Visit the Wooden Boat Centre in Franklin, wander off to small cideries and fruit stands along the roadside, or take quiet walks through bushland reserves just outside of town.
